Why YouTube Buffers Frequently on Huawei Devices
Weak or Unstable Connectivity Slows the Video Preload
Process
YouTube must download video data
continuously to maintain smooth playback. If the network signal weakens or
fluctuates, the app pauses to catch up. A user may see the loading circle
appear repeatedly even when the Wi-Fi icon looks full. Hidden factors like
temporary interference, router distance, or congested networks often create
these hiccups. Mobile data can also shift between strong and weak bands,
causing sudden drops in streaming speed. When the connection cannot maintain
steady throughput, YouTube lowers the quality or stalls completely. Many users
solve this by switching bands, improving router placement, or forcing the
device onto a more stable channel.
App Cache and Temporary Files Conflict With Ongoing
Playback
YouTube stores thumbnails, scripts, and
fragments of videos locally to speed up loading. But once these files pile up,
they sometimes slow the app instead of helping. Large caches can confuse the
app during video transitions or force it to reload data unnecessarily. This
produces buffering even on fast networks. Corrupted cache files can also
disrupt resolution switching or block smooth playback when videos jump from one
quality level to another. Clearing out these files gives YouTube a clean start,
letting it fetch new video data without interference.
Browser Settings or External Players Add Extra Loading
Steps
Many Huawei users stream through a browser
instead of the YouTube app. This works well but increases the chance of
buffering if the browser restricts scripts, blocks autoplay, or delays
media-loading permissions. When JavaScript is limited or energy-saving mode
kicks in, streaming slows down noticeably. Some users enable background limits
to conserve battery, but this prevents the browser from preloading the next
seconds of the video. Additionally, certain browsers refresh tabs too
aggressively, interrupting the stream and forcing the user to reload the entire
page. Adjusting browser permissions or switching to a more streaming-friendly
browser often fixes this instantly.
How Huawei Users Can Reduce YouTube Buffering Immediately
Improve Network Stability With Better Band Selection and
Router Placement
A quick way to reduce buffering is to choose
the stronger network band. Most routers offer 2.4 GHz and 5 GHz. The 5 GHz band
delivers faster speeds but struggles through walls; 2.4 GHz reaches farther but
is prone to congestion. Huawei devices handle both well, so selecting the one
with the least interference boosts streaming quality. Placing the router away
from thick walls, metal surfaces, or other electronics also improves
consistency. If you use mobile data, locking the device to a stable mode—such as 4G only—prevents sudden network drops caused by
automatic switching. These small adjustments give YouTube a constant flow of
data.

Clear App Cache or Browser Cache to Remove Conflicting
Files
Clearing the cache rejuvenates the YouTube
app or browser by removing old scripts and temporary files that slow video
loading. On the app version, clearing cache does not delete downloads or
account data, so it’s completely safe. It removes stuck thumbnails and resets outdated
playback files. For browser users, clearing cache forces the site to fetch
fresh video elements, improving responsiveness and reducing pauses. Many Huawei
users notice a significant improvement after this step because it eliminates internal
conflicts that previously stalled the playback engine. Restarting the browser
or app afterward ensures all changes apply correctly.
Adjust Playback Settings and Disable Power-Saving
Interference
YouTube automatically picks the best
quality, but if the connection varies, it jumps between resolutions. Manually
selecting a stable resolution—such as 480p or 720p—keeps the stream smooth even during minor network dips. This
prevents abrupt pauses caused by resolution switching. Huawei’s power-saving features can also restrict
background data or limit how aggressively apps download content. When these
settings activate, YouTube cannot buffer far enough ahead to cover
fluctuations. Turning off power-saving mode or granting YouTube unlimited data
access stabilizes streaming. If using a browser, disabling battery-saving
restrictions ensures that the tab remains active and allowed to preload media.
